Application Programming Interface (API)

Application Programming Interface (API) is a set of protocols, routines, and tools that governs how software components should interact, creating a bridge between disparate software systems. Coursera's API catalogue provides you with a comprehensive understanding of how to design, implement, and maintain APIs. You'll learn about various types of APIs like REST, SOAP, and GraphQL, along with API testing, documentation, and best practices for security. You'll gain hands-on experience in integrating APIs in web, mobile, and cloud applications and understand their role in facilitating seamless connectivity in the digital world. Mastering API skills will position you as a valuable asset in any software, web development, or cloud computing team.
70credentials
369courses

Related roles

Gain the knowledge and skills you need to advance.

  • This role has a £78,310 median salary ¹.

    description:

    An iOS Developer builds and maintains iOS apps, optimizes performance and compatibility using Swift and iOS SDK across Apple’s ecosystem.

    This role has a £78,310 median salary ¹.

    Offered by

    Meta_logo
    University of Toronto_logo
    LearnQuest_logo
  • This role has a £48,005 median salary ¹.

    description:

    An Application Developer designs, develops, and maintains software, ensuring functionality and user satisfaction using Java, Python, and C#.

    This role has a £48,005 median salary ¹.

    Offered by

    Microsoft_logo
    Google Cloud_logo

Most popular

Trending now

New releases

Filter by

Subject
Required

Language
Required

The language used throughout the course, in both instruction and assessments.

Learning Product
Required

Build job-relevant skills in under 2 hours with hands-on tutorials.
Learn from top instructors with graded assignments, videos, and discussion forums.
Learn a new tool or skill in an interactive, hands-on environment.
Get in-depth knowledge of a subject by completing a series of courses and projects.
Earn career credentials from industry leaders that demonstrate your expertise.

Level
Required

Duration
Required

Subtitles
Required

Educator
Required

Results for "application programming interface (api)"

  • Skills you'll gain: Test Automation, Application Programming Interface (API), Test Case, Restful API, Software Testing, Configuration Management, Java, Software Configuration Management

  • Skills you'll gain: Google Gemini, Google Cloud Platform, Multimodal Prompts, Generative AI, LLM Application, Prompt Engineering, Application Programming Interface (API), Software Installation

  • Skills you'll gain: Cloud API, Application Programming Interface (API), Google Cloud Platform, Cloud Security, Load Balancing, Threat Management, Threat Detection

  • Coursera Project Network

    Skills you'll gain: Application Programming Interface (API), Test Tools, Behavior-Driven Development, Test Automation

  • Skills you'll gain: API Gateway, Cloud API, Application Programming Interface (API), Google Cloud Platform, Web Services, Scalability, Server Side, Data Management, Network Analysis

  • Skills you'll gain: API Gateway, Cloud API, Application Programming Interface (API), Web Services, Google Cloud Platform, Web Applications, Application Development, Authentications

  • Status: Free

    Skills you'll gain: Application Programming Interface (API), Restful API, Web Services, Cloud Services, C# (Programming Language), Server Side, Application Development, Development Environment

  • Skills you'll gain: Cloud API, Google Cloud Platform, Cloud Computing, Application Programming Interface (API), Apache Spark

  • Skills you'll gain: MySQL, Database Management, Cloud API, Application Programming Interface (API), Data Import/Export, Cloud Storage

  • Skills you'll gain: Restful API, Cloud API, Application Programming Interface (API), Postman API Platform, Java Programming, Java, Mobile Development, Apache Maven, Web Development, Eclipse (Software), Software Design

  • Skills you'll gain: OAuth, API Gateway, Application Programming Interface (API), Authentications, Secure Coding, Application Security, Authorization (Computing), Debugging, Data Access, Data Analysis

  • Skills you'll gain: Image Analysis, Cloud API, Cloud Storage, Google Cloud Platform, Application Programming Interface (API), Computer Vision

What brings you to Coursera today?

Leading partners

  • Google Cloud
  • Packt
  • Scrimba
  • Pearson
  • Meta
  • EDUCBA
  • Edureka
  • Microsoft